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Sydney Opera House to Mudgee is to bus which costs $30 - $45 and takes 7h 35m.
The fastest way to get from Sydney Opera House to Mudgee is to drive which takes 3h 25m and costs $50 - $80.
No, there is no direct bus from Sydney Opera House station to Mudgee station. However, there are services departing from Martin Place Station, Elizabeth St, Stand F and arriving at Mudgee Station, Coach Stop via Central Station, Forecourt, Coach Bay 1 and Lithgow Station, Railway Pde, Bay 3.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 7h 35m.
The distance between Sydney Opera House and Mudgee is 305 km. The road distance is 265.2 km.
The best way to get from Sydney Opera House to Mudgee without a car is to bus which takes 7h 35m and costs $30 - $45.
It takes approximately 7h 35m to get from Sydney Opera House to Mudgee, including transfers.
Sydney Opera House to Mudgee bus services, operated by NSW TrainLink, depart from Central Station, Forecourt, Coach Bay 1.
Sydney Opera House to Mudgee bus services, operated by NSW TrainLink, arrive at Lithgow Station, Railway Pde, Bay 1.
Yes, the driving distance between Sydney Opera House to Mudgee is 265 km. It takes approximately 3h 25m to drive from Sydney Opera House to Mudgee.
